The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ary vs. University of Mary Hardin-Baylor
Graduate-focused Baptist seminary in Fort Worth with 2,782 students and tuition of $10,584 annually.
University of Mary Hardin-Baylor
Private liberal arts university in Texas with strong focus on health professions and open admissions.

| Metric | The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ary | University of Mary Hardin-Baylor |
|---|---|---|
| Acceptance Rate | 52.7% | 95.1% |
| Annual In-State Tuition | $10,584 | $31,650 |
| Annual Out-of-State Tuition | $10,584 | $31,650 |
| Endowment (End of Year) | $153,716,305 | $123,439,591 |
| Room and Board | $8,990 | $12,716 |
| Total Cost of Attendance (In-State) | $19,574 | $44,366 |
| Total Cost of Attendance (Out-of-State) | $19,574 | $44,366 |
| Total Student Enrollment | 2,782 | 3,520 |
